Acadian Ambulance is currently seeking a candidate for the position of Community Relations Supervisor (CRS) in Baton Rouge, LA.

The CRS maintains and grows market share by establishing and building relationships with other healthcare providers, elected officials, and civic leaders. The selected individual will also manage PST patients and represent the company at community functions.

Job Responsibilities

Call on nursing homes to establish relationships and solicit business; handle all questions, inquiries, and needs of this client base.

Call on hospitals to establish relationships and solicit business; handle all questions, inquiries, and needs of this client base.

Assist Regional VP's with public inquiries

Manage all PST patient’s (dialysis, radiology, etc.), including assessments and appropriate documentation.

Attend community functions and events to represent the company

Participate in NHA functions, including conventions and conferences

Work with Regional VP's and management team to establish and maintain relationships with elected officials; attend municipal and parish governmental meetings.

Assist with development of marketing plans for all product lines.

Help to develop contracts with local facilities and healthcare systems

Participation in Chambers of Commerce and other civic organizations.

Assist with media relations.

Collaborate with operations, ATAC and dispatch to create and refine processes that enhance the customer experience and increase revenue.

Collaborate with operations and leadership to develop and deliver reporting that is required by our customers.

Positions Skills/Qualifications

High School Diploma or GED required.

National and/or State certification as an Emergency Medical Technician or Paramedic determined by appropriate state requirements - 2 years experience preferred.

Current American Heart Association BCLS instructor or agrees to obtain.

Healthcare Marketing and/or Customer service experience - 2 years experience preferred.

Excellent interpersonal and communication skills.

Experience working with Microsoft Office products such as Word, Excel or their Google Equivalent is preferred.
